“We did things according to the rules”: Nîmes Olympique wants to remain focused on the reception of the Red Star despite the sword of Damocles
Séance rythmée et enlevée à La Bastide, ce jeudi 25 avril, pour Doucouré, Mbemba et les Nîmois. Midi Libre - Thierry Albenque
The Crocos are working hard to be able to stand up to the Parisian leader, Monday April 29, for the 31st day of National. Without worrying about the complaint made by Orléans after their 1-0 victory in Loiret.
The rest day, Wednesday, was good. The Crocos had desire and gas this Thursday morning (April 25) at La Bastide. The one and a half hour session was fast-paced and lively. The players put intensity into their interventions, Sbaï and Picouleau, each in turn, remaining on the ground for a few seconds after a rough contact.

Quality and intensity
"There was a lot of quality, I'm pleasantly surprised", appreciated Adil Hermach afterwards, he who had launched a "Bravo everyone !"  ;at the end of the training. The crocodile coach, who would like to “continue every three days”, made a good turn against bad luck with this Red Star reception postponed to Monday. "This allows us to perfect our plan."

The tactical work carried out, in fact, was entirely focused on this meeting against the undisputed and indisputable leader of the National, only four defeats on the clock. Match situations – "Freeze frames", as Hermach calls them – have been "worked and reworked", rather successfully.
Explore very quickly when recovering, anticipate ball losses, ensure ball releases, alternate short play (placed attacks) and direct play (quick attacks), "we have seen quite a few things compared to Red Star's game, confided Adil Hermach, who had banned balls in the air and asked his players to be "technically precise"" ;nbsp;and lucid: "When things stink behind us, we send !"
A 4-2-3-1 without surprise
If on Tuesday, during the oppositions at the end of the session, he had alternated between defense of 4 and defense of 5, this Thursday, during the tactical implementation, the technical staff did not balance between the two systems, the first option being favored in a classic way with, in front of Paradowski, the Sbaï-Diouf-Mendy-Diallo quartet.
It was in 4-2-3-1 that the Nîmes worked, with a Doukansy-Picouleau doublet in recovery, Mbemba and Camara in the corridors, Mexico being positioned in support of Mbina . As the chasuble changed, we then saw Doucouré, Khalid and Sacko in the team of probable holders.
Lamgahez affair: "We did things according to the rules"
Holder, precisely, during the last two days, the young Zakary Lamgahez did not leave the team of substitutes. As we know, the 21-year-old defender is at the center of the complaint brought by Orléans (read Midi Libre on April 24 and 25), which calls into question the validity of his participation in the match lost 1-0 by the Loiret club last Friday.
"We did things according to the rules and Zak's license (who played and won three Coupe de France matches, Editor's note) was validated as it should have been. rsquo;to be", repeated yesterday sports director Sébastien Larcier, who recalled: "On Selmane's license (El Hamri, top scorer of the reserve, federal contract at Beaucaire last season, reclassified amateur to NO, Editor's note), it is written in black and white that he cannot participate in the National championship. On Zak's, there is nothing written…"
Montpellier, Bourges, Nîmes
"The system, we insist at the club, did not block when we applied for a license for Lamgahez." Request made last August 28 for the former professional trainee from Montpellier HSC who, before arriving in Nîmes, we must not forget, had made a detour via Bourges (N2, he signed there on July 6) where the story ended.
The Federal Settlements and Litigation Commission is expected to study the matter next Tuesday. By then, the crocodile club, sure of being in the right, will have sent him its observations.
Labonne (left ankle) and Paviot (right thigh) are in the rehabilitation phase. Their return to the group is hoped for next week. Burner (adductors) is still in treatment. Season over for Sané (right adductors). Nîmes (13th, 35 points) - Red Star (1st, 62 points), Monday April 29 at 9 p.m. at Les Antonins. Single rate 5 €.
